On-line coupling of the TRIGA-SPEC facility at the research reactor TRIGA Mainz — •Dennis Renisch — Institut für Kernchemie, Johannes Gutenberg-Universität, Mainz, Germany

To determine ground-state properties of exotic nuclides, the TRIGA-SPEC experiment at the TRIGA Mainz research reactor was recently installed. It includes the Penning-trap mass spectrometer TRIGA-TRAP and the collinear laser spectroscopy setup TRIGA-LASER. Nuclides of interest are produced via neutron-induced fission of suitable actinoide isotopes, thermalized in a gas-filled volume and transported with a gas-jet system to an on-line ion source. Ionization of the fission products occurs inside a hot cavity of the ion source, which is heated by electron bombardment to temperatures of about 2000°C. The ion beam is extracted by a high potential difference and mass separated by a 90° dipole magnet. Afterwards, the ion beam is injected into an RF-cooler/buncher and finally decelerated by a pulsed drift tube so that the ions can be captured in a Penning trap. The efficiencies of the different parts of the beamline were tested recently and the latest results about the performance will be presented.
